A pickup truck is a light-duty truck possessing an enclosed cab and an open cargo location with lower sides and tailgate.[1] When a operate device with handful of creature comforts, in the 1950s, buyers started buying pickups for life style motives, and by the 1990s, significantly less than 15% of owners reported use in perform as the pickup truck's main goal.[2] Nowadays in North America, the pickup is mostly utilised like a passenger vehicle[3] and accounts for about 18% of complete cars sold in the US.[4]The term pickup is of unknown origin. It was used by Studebaker in 1913 and by the 1930s, "pick-up" (hyphenated) had turn out to be the normal phrase.[5] In Australia and New Zealand, "ute", short for utility motor vehicle, is utilized for the two pickups and coupé utilities. In South Africa, people of all language groups use the phrase bakkie, a diminutive of bak, Afrikaans for bowl/container, due to the cargo location's similarities with a bowl and container.
